What is a County CFO?

County CFOs, or County Chief Financial Officers, are senior officials responsible for overseeing the financial operations of a county government. Their duties include managing budgets, preparing financial reports, ensuring compliance with laws and regulations, and advising county officials on fiscal matters. They play a crucial role in planning, directing, and coordinating financial activities to ensure the county’s financial stability and transparency. County CFOs also often supervise accounting and finance staff and work closely with other departments to allocate resources effectively.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a County CFO?

To thrive as a County CFO, you need a robust background in finance, accounting, and public administration, usually supported by a bachelor's or master's degree in accounting or finance and relevant CPA or CGFM certification. Familiarity with government accounting software, budget management systems, and compliance tools is essential. Strong leadership, strategic thinking, and effective communication enable collaboration with government officials and departments. These skills ensure sound fiscal management, regulatory compliance, and effective stewardship of public funds.

How does a County CFO typically collaborate with other county departments to ensure effective budgeting and financial management?

A County CFO regularly works with department heads, elected officials, and administrative staff to develop, monitor, and adjust the county’s budget. This collaboration often involves coordinating budget requests, providing financial guidance, and ensuring compliance with state and local regulations. The CFO also leads meetings, reviews financial reports from various departments, and helps set fiscal priorities to align with the county’s strategic goals. Strong communication and negotiation skills are essential, as the CFO must balance diverse interests and facilitate consensus among stakeholders.

What is the difference between County Cfo vs County Treasurer?

AspectCounty CfoCounty Treasurer
Primary ResponsibilitiesManaging county finances, budgeting, financial planningCollecting and disbursing funds, maintaining financial records of receipts and payments
Required CredentialsAccounting or finance degree, CPA often preferredAccounting background, sometimes CPA or finance degree
Work EnvironmentGovernment offices, financial departmentsCounty offices, treasury departments
Industry UsageUsed in local government finance managementUsed in managing county funds and cash flow

The County Cfo and County Treasurer roles both involve financial management within county government but focus on different areas. The County Cfo oversees overall financial planning and budgeting, while the County Treasurer handles cash flow and fund disbursements. Both positions require strong accounting credentials and are essential for effective county financial operations.

ITA is seeking a Chief Financial Officer to join the team supporting our Headquarters location in Newport News, Virginia.  This is a hybrid position.

Responsibilities

The Chief Financial Officer (CFO) is responsible for providing strategic financial leadership for our current organization, while serving as a key executive partner in driving growth through acquisitions. This role oversees all financial operations, ensures compliance with federal contracting regulations, and leads financial strategy related to mergers, acquisitions, integrations, and long-term value creation. 

  • Serve as the strategic advisor to the CEO, executive leadership team, and Board of Advisors on financial strategy and corporate performance
  • Provide strategic financial leadership to the executive team, supporting organic growth and acquisition-driven expansion 
  • Build and lead high-performing teams for financial planning, budgeting, analysis, and accounting 
  • Manage cash flow and tax planning across the enterprise 
  • Oversee all accounting, financial reporting, and internal controls in compliance with FAR, CAS, GAAP, DCAA, and DCMA requirements 
  • Serve as financial lead for mergers and acquisitions, including target evaluation, due diligence, valuation, deal structuring, integration planning, and investor relations 
  • Drive financial integration and value realization following acquisitions, ensuring achievement of synergy targets and successful operational integration
  • Manage relationships with lenders, investors, auditors, banks, and government oversight organizations 
  • Maintain and/or modify allocation structures and ensure accurate indirect rates, monthly closings and consolidations 
  • Provide pricing strategy, and financial inputs for proposals and capture activities 
  • Oversee risk management, compliance, insurance, and audit readiness 
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in Finance, Accounting, Business, or related field (MBA or CPA strongly preferred) 
  • 15+ years of progressive financial leadership experience, including senior executive roles 
  • Demonstrated experience in government contracting environments (DoD and/or civilian agencies) 
  • Proven track record leading or supporting mergers and acquisitions, including valuations, due diligence and integration of acquired companies 
  • Deep understanding of FAR, CAS, DCAA audits, indirect rate management, and government pricing 
  • Experience supporting proposal pricing, cost volumes, and competitive capture strategies 
  • Strong analytical, leadership, and communication skills with the ability to influence at the executive and board level through data driven analysis and modeling 
  • Experience scaling organizations through acquisitions and organic growth 
  • Direct experience in leading acquisitions from modeling and analysis, negotiations, due diligence, financing, closing, and integration 
  • Experience working directly with company owners on strategic planning and financial performance
